Averbuch, Eveland & Rodenbough Earn District Academic All-America Honors


Three members of the UNC's women's soccer team -- senior midfielder of Upper Montclair, N.J., senior goalkeeper Anna Rodenbough of Greensboro, N.C. and junior defender Kristi Eveland of Southlake, Texas -- were all named Thursday to the District Three Academic All-America Team presented by ESPN The Magazine an as selected by the College Sports Information Directors of America.
